The colors your mix and the placement of paint on your canvas both rely on one major factor, its light source. Look at your subject, and decide exactly where the lightest places and the darkest components are. Mix your paints with these in mind, making numerous shades or tints of a single color to effectively blend colors together if required.Think about your purpose. A bid that is "scribbled down on a napkin" is "not even comparable," says Benson.Inspect the siding and trim, specially close to drains and gutters, where ice and water might have taken a toll. If the harm or paint erosion is substantial, pull out the calendar to strategy the job. Schedule a single complete day to clean the property exterior with a stress washer. A week later, you will require at least a day to scrape, sand, caulk and prime the worn spots. Seek a written estimate from each and every contractor. It need to incorporate a breakdown of labor, material expenses, the quantity of coats of primer and paint, the brand and model of components, and a detailed description of the quantity of surface preparation that will be carried out.A little primer goes a extended way.
